What is RAM

Something more about RAM. RAM, standing for RealMediA Metafile, is one of RealMedia formats used by RealMedia player, which contains compressed audio and video data. Real Media Player used to be very popular in the early days of the Internet for streaming video and audio over modem connections because it provided superior compression. Some websites require the installation of RealPlayer Plug-in before it can properly open some contents of the pages. Most of these websites are internet radios that transmit real time broadcast using RealPlayer.

What is YouTube

Do you know YouTube? YouTube is a video sharing website on which users can upload and share videos. YouTube's video playback technology for web users is based on the Adobe Flash Player. This allows the site to display videos with quality comparable to more established video playback technologies that generally require the user to download and install a web browser plug-in to view video content. Viewing Flash video also requires a plug-in. Videos uploaded to YouTube are limited to ten minutes in length and a file size of 2 GB.
